Phys. Rev. ST Accel. Beams 9, 054401 (2006) [8 pages]Transverse impedance of axially symmetric tapered structures
B. Podobedov and S. Krinsky Received 4 April 2006; published 24 May 2006 We determine the low frequency transverse impedance of axially symmetric tapered structures. Higher-order perturbation theory is used to improve previous estimates due to Yokoya and Stupakov. For linear tapers, accurate numerical results are obtained using the abci electromagnetic simulation code. Based upon insight gained from the perturbation calculations, we introduce a simple parametrization that provides an excellent fit to all of our abci data—including cases with gradual and steep tapers as well as large and small change in cross section. ©2006 The American Physical Society
